About this strategy

Nimble :: Trading SPX using Volatility.

The system derives information from various SPX volatility indices and uses it to issue short-term signals, with an average horizon of 2-3 days. These signals are traded using ETFs that track the SP500 index and the VIX futures, directly or inversely. The trades are automatic, handled by an algorithm, but monitored by the system creator.

No stop prices are set, but the system also issues longer-term signals with an average horizon of 1 month, attempting to predict larger moves of the market. These signals are used to manually buy cheap OTM options that hedge the main short-term system against adverse market moves.

No margin is used.
